[英]how can I make a html scrollbar start at the bottom?
我正在嘗試為聊天框創建一個可滾動區域,但我的滾動條從頂部開始而不是從底部開始。 這意味着在向下滾動之前,您會看到所有第一條消息,但不會顯示所有新消息。 這個聊天框會收到很多消息,所以條形圖需要從底部開始。
這是我到目前為止在JQuery中得到的,但它不起作用
$('#chatbox').each(function(){
$(this).scrollTop($(this).prop('scrollHeight'));
});
那么如何讓滾動條保持在滾動的底部?
編輯:現在使用此代碼。 它繞到中間,但不是底部。
$('#chatbox').animate({
scrollTop: $('#chatbox').height()}, 0
);
好吧我明白了。 這是讓它工作的代碼:
$('#chatbox').animate({
scrollTop: $("#chatbox").prop("scrollHeight")}, 0
);
或者對於非動畫:
$("#chatbox").prop({ scrollTop: $("#chatbox").prop("scrollHeight") });
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.